Originally Posted by box986
hi Sclemmons & Holli82, does your car have the black rubber gasket around the intake on both sides? My X51 with Factory Aero only happens to have it on the right side, not sure if X51 cars without Aero has it on both sides?
Your lid is complete. You're not missing any parts.

The plastic piece on the right side matches the intake on the left side that all the aero cars have to meet up with the standard, non x51 intake. Standard aero lids just have a flat area on the right side where the second intake is cut into the lid and the plastic piece clips in to finish out the hole and seal to the air box.
